Output 0d366cac4d1851ef6b4f04c9b8fe1e5f30d07133a25113e57f5d4cbc7e58dfab:0

value
16990450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c643a984a35e5dc5167d5e9451d1d2191f6f56 OP_EQUAL
address
3FSEnxrLXhAR1i5oEud42QcTYnaWE8Dwex
transaction
0d366cac4d1851ef6b4f04c9b8fe1e5f30d07133a25113e57f5d4cbc7e58dfab
confirmations
305912
spent
true